Dimitri Bouchène, born April 26, 1893 in St-Tropez and died February 6, 1993 in Paris, was a Russian painter who became a French citizen in 1947. A costume and set designer for theater, ballet, and opera, and a designer for haute couture, he was also a landscape and still life painter. In Paris in 1926, Dimitri Bouchène designed costumes for Anna Pavlova before working for haute couture houses (Lucien Lelong, Jean Patou, Nina Ricci, Lanvin, etc.).
